WebFeb 10, 2024 · Why is documenting feedback so vital? Customer feedback can come from various channels. Channels which include app reviews, customer calls, emails, in-app feedback, survey results, in-person interviews, beta sessions, and more. WebNov 20, 2024 · Create consistent rating scales. Avoid leading or loaded questions. 2. Email and customer contact forms. Email is one of the easiest ways to gather candid customer feedback. Because it’s a support channel for most companies, you can use each interaction as an opportunity to gather feedback.
